Default super blackbird fuel pump not priming

I wonder if anyone can help?. Left blackbird in my garage not started for 3 years when put jump pack on it started but sounded like running on 2 cylinders turned pack off bike stopped. so bought new battery put on now fuel pump not priming no noise when key turns . Looked at fuses and relays all seems ok and bike just turns over as pump not priming .Fi light goes out and hiss key light goes out even tried spare key no joy. Have had bike from new 2000 FI model .Any ideas please guys !!

Hi , have you tried running a direct feed to the pump to see if it will run independently, could be a lot of dirt in the tank after 3 years, and new petrol could help, check out page 5-58 of the workshop manual

Hi Tim, all you need is good motorcycle wire , and run one from the negative pole of the battery to the Green connector of the pump , and one wire from the Positive pole of the battery to the Brown connector of the pump,take the battery off the bike to do this, but I think after 3 years your going to have to take the pump out to clean it, that could be why your pump isn't priming (blocked up)
